West of Boston is a three part novel that takes place in the Northwestern United States and Canada during the late 1950s. The central character, David Fitzgerald, is a naïve, sheltered 18-year-old young man from Boston who travels to the Northwest in search of adventure. He becomes involved in events that are sometimes comical, sometimes romantic, and at other times sobering - even life threatening. He is thus propelled into maturity and manhood over a five-year period. Seasoned with contemporary ranch life of Montana and Alberta, the major parts of West of Boston take place in the wilderness of British Columbia. All the characters and story plots are fictional though realistic with solid family values.
